Just noticed this [link](http://msdn.microsoft.com/asp.net/default.aspx?pull=/library/en-us/dnaspp/html/acsaraf1.asp) in [a post](http://weblogs.asp.net/ksharkey/archive/2004/05/27/143141.aspx) on [Kent Sharkeys](http://weblogs.asp.net/ksharkey) blog. The [article](http://msdn.microsoft.com/asp.net/default.aspx?pull=/library/en-us/dnaspp/html/acsaraf1.asp) by [Scott Mitchell](http://scottonwriting.net/)covers various methods of making ASP.NET 1.1 based sites conform to WAI accessibility guidelines (or US Section 508 if you prefer :-)).
